[ WEBINAR TODAY ] Ensuring store safety and compliance with Mobile Auditing Technology

Reflexis – now part of Zebra Technologies – recently undertook a survey of 500 retail workers.

They discovered that 75% felt that their roles had become more complex since the pandemic, with 56% citing new customer and personal safety compliance measures as the main areas of added complexity.

Date/Time: 24th March, 1.30pm – 1.50pm GMT 

Paper-based legacy systems such as check lists reduce the effectiveness of auditing processes. This makes real-time visibility of task execution almost impossible and means effective analysis of trends is often non-existent with reports simply filed away never to be found again. Retailers need a combined solution of simple reporting and data capture through mobile digital auditing and checklist technology to ensure compliance in their stores.
